The Future of Technology:  hydro, Aquaponics, and Aeroponics. The ever-changing landscape of technology can be difficult to keep up with. But if you like to be on the cutting edge, you'll want to learn about hydroponics, aquaponics, and aeroponics. These are three innovative new methods of growing plants that are taking the world by storm. The Benefits of Hydroponics, Aquaponics, and Aeroponics If you're looking for a more efficient and sustainable way to grow your plants, then you should definitely consider hydro, aquaponics, or aeroponics. These methods of growing plants use less water and energy than traditional methods, and they can be done indoors, making them ideal for urban areas.  How Hydroponics, Aquaponics, and Aeroponics Work The same principle underlies hydroponics, aquaponics, and aeroponics: the cultivation of plants without the use of soil. Instead, they are grown in water or in a mist. This technique may sound strange, but it's actually a very effective way to grow plants. The Future of Food: Hydroponics, Aquaponics, and Aeroponics The world's population is expected to reach 9 billion by 2050, and traditional methods of farming will not be able to keep up with the demand. This is where hydroponics, aquaponics, and aeroponics come in. These methods of growing food are more efficient and sustainable, and they will be essential in feeding the world's growing population.  The Future of Farming: Hydroponics, Aquaponics, and Aeroponics Farming is changing, and hydroponics, aquaponics, and aeroponics are leading the way. These methods of growing plants are more efficient, more sustainable, and more productive. They are the future of farming, and they will help to feed the world's growing population.
